Get started12 North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Handsworth, Birmingham, Birmingham (B20 3HX). It has a recorded floor area of 71 m² (around 764 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(August 2025)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in June 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and window ef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 72).
Sale prices here have outpaced Birmingham HPI: 3.1%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£154,000 is 21.3%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£166/sq ft) was about 85.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old July 2021 for £127,000.
